how many bytes difference will there be in the amount of memory allocated by the following code on the intel ia 32 versus the intel x86-64?
By using operations on integers, it can be calculated that
Difference between the amount of memory allocated by char*arr[3] on the intel ia 32 versus the intel x86-64 is 12 bytes

On Intel IA 32, the address is 32 bit or 32 [tex]\div[/tex] 8 = 4 bytes
On Intel x86 - 64, the address is 64 bit or 64 [tex]\div[/tex] 8 = 8 bytes
On an array of size 3,
On Intel IA 32, the address is 4 [tex]\times[/tex] 3 bytes = 12 bytes
On Intel x86 - 64, the address is 8 [tex]\times[/tex] 3 bytes = 24 bytes
Difference between the address = 24 - 12 = 12 bytes
Difference between the amount of memory allocated by char*arr[3] on the intel ia 32 versus the intel x86-64 is 12 bytes

two cities are 145 miles apart. a truck travels this distance in 2.5 hours. a car is 1.5 times as fast as the truck. how long does it take for the car and the truck to meet if they leave at the same time, and travel toward each other
By using the travel distance formula, we found out that it takes 1 hour for the car and the truck to meet if they leave at the same time and travel toward each other.
It is given to us that -
Two cities are 145 miles apart
Truck travels this distance in 2.5 hours
Car is 1.5 times as fast as the truck
We have to find out the time taken for the car and the truck to meet if they leave at the same time, and travel toward each other.
We know that -
[tex]Speed = \frac{Distance}{Time}[/tex] ----- (1)
Let us say that the speed of the truck is given by [tex]S_{t}[/tex] and the speed of the car is given by [tex]S_{c}[/tex].
Now, from equation (1), we can say that the speed of the truck,
[tex]S_{t}=\frac{145}{2.5} \\= > S_{t}= 58 miles per hour[/tex] ----- (2)
It is given to us that the car is 1.5 times as fast as the truck
=> [tex]S_{c}= 1.5 * 58\\= > S_{c}= 87 miles per hour[/tex] ----- (3)
It is mentioned that the car and the truck leave at the same time to meet each other.
Let us say that the truck meets the car at a distance 'd'.
This implies that the distance travelled by the car to meet the truck at a given point = (145-d) --- (4)
From equation (1), we can say that
[tex]Time = \frac{Distance}{Speed}[/tex]
Also, we know that -
Time taken by truck to travel d miles = Time taken by car to travel (145-d) miles
[tex]\frac{d}{58}=\frac{145-d}{87} \\= > 87d = 8410-58d\\= > 145d=8410\\= > d = 58[/tex]
Thus, the truck will travel 58 miles to meet car after they leave at the same time.
So, the time taken for the car and truck to meet =
[tex]\frac{58 miles}{58 miles per hour} = 1 hour[/tex]
Therefore, according to the distance formula, it takes 1 hour for the car and the truck to meet if they leave at the same time and travel toward each other.

31. the measures of 2 angles are in the ratio 5:3. the measure of the larger angle is 30 greater than half the difference of the angles. find the measure of each angle.
The correct answer is the measure of two angles are 37.5° and 22.5°.
It is given that the measure of two angles are in the ratio 5:3 . Let the one angle be 5x and the other angle be 3x.
Difference of the angles = 5x - 3x
According to the question, the measure of the larger angle is 30° greater than half the difference of the angles
Thus we can write it as:
⇒ 5x - 1/2(5x-3x) =30°
⇒ 10x- (5x-3x) = 60°
⇒ 8x = 60°
⇒ x = 7.5°
Thus, the larger angle = 5x = 5×7.5= 37.5° and the smaller angle = 3x = 3× 7.5 = 22.5°
Hence, the measure of two angles are 37.5° and 22.5°.

Which pair of triangles can be proved congruent by ASA?.
Answer: If any two angles and the side included between the angles of one triangle are equivalent to the corresponding two angles and side included between the angles of the second triangle, then the two triangles are said to be congruent by ASA rule.
The Angle Side Angle Postulate (ASA) says triangles are congruent if any two angles and their included side are equal in the triangles. An included side is the side between two angles.

at the start of 2014 tims house was worth £100,000
the value of the house increased by 10% every year
work out the value of his house at the start of 2018
The value of Tim's house at the start of 2018 is £146410
How to determine the value of his house at the start of 2018?From the question, we have the following parameters that can be used in our computation:
Initial value = 100,000
Rate of increase = 10%
The value of the house x years after 2014 can be represented as the following exponential function
Value = Initial value * (1 + rate)ˣ
So, we have
Value = 100000 * (1 + 10%)ˣ
2018 is 4 years after 2014
This means that x = 4
So, we have
Value = 100000 * (1 + 10%)⁴
Evaluate
Value = 146410
Hence, the value is #146410
